ARSENEAU, Lilianne (née LeBreton)
The song is ended but the melody lingers on. It is with great sadness that the family of Lilianne Arseneau (nee LeBreton) announces her passing Sunday, September 17th 2017, in Sudbury, at the age of 81. Daughter of the late Edmond LeBreton and of the late Julie Anne LeBreton. Beloved wife of Alvida Arseneau (predeceased) of Coniston. Loving mother of Brenda Arseneau (husband Laurence) of Toronto, Denise Clouthier (husband Jerry) of Sudbury and Betty Arseneau of Sudbury. Predeceased by her son Michel and her daughters Suzanne and Paulette. Dear sister of Eva Mallais (late Felix) and Lorraine Dignard (late Alvida). Predeceased by her siblings Wilfred Arseneault (late Irène), Isaie Arseneault (late Marge), Arthur LeBreton (Verna), Clarence LeBreton (late Bernadette) and Gerald LeBreton (late Thérèse). Sadly missed and lovingly remembered by her grandchildren Chelsey, Chessa, Chad and Marilyne. Her great grandchildren Chase, Charlee and Chance. Mrs. Arseneau was a devoted housewife and mother with a huge heart who loved to laugh and enjoy life to the fullest. She was an active member in her church community for almost 20 years helping with the cooking, cleaning and serving dinners at church functions. She always looked forward to camping at her trailer at the Noëlville Camp & Trailer Park, as well as rejoicing with the Club Rigodon in Coniston. Lilianne also loved to bowl and play cards in her free time. We would like to thank the staff at Extendicare Falconbridge for their compassionate care. “Memere” will be greatly missed by her grandchildren who she loved dearly and who were her pride and joy.
